Revised parameters for vessels at CJ-I

27 Dec 2022 / Tuticorin, India

The VOC Port Authority for Tuticorin port have issued a notice indicating revised parameters for the berthing of vessels at CJ-I as per below. The port has dismantled the older CJ-I jetty and constructed a new jetty equipped with x2 shore unloaders. Presently, trial runs are underway and no vessels are accepted at CJ-I.

Quay length (in mtrs): 301

Permissable LOA (in mtrs): 230

Permissible draught (in mtrs): 14.2 (such vessels to be handled during daylight hours and utilising a tide of at least 0.65 mtrs, in rising tide)

DWT (in mt): 80,000
